I think for Aprils theme, I am going to give you ladies a choice, that way you can surprise your partners.
Theme 1, April Showers bring May Flowers
Theme 2, Easter (As Easter is early this year, April 5th) Please, no religious as we may all be different affiliations or no affiliations. (To each his own.)

May's theme, is all shapes and sizes. You could do a different shape postcard, or you can do something that represents different shapes and sizes in your piecing, or quilting, or applique. You decide. It will be fun. I already have so many different ideas.

June's theme will be in the "Good Ol' Summertime". Anything that kicks of your summer celebrations. Think back to the anticipation to summer when we were kids. What comes to mind for you? Is it friends, swimming, the beach, camping, picking berries etc.

And, of course, July will be Independence Day, 4th of July, (For our Non-American swappers, if there is a special holiday in July that you celebrate, Please, share or convey that on your postcard.) If not, the colors, are RED, WHITE, and BLUE.
